ABOUT

 

Hope 4 Autism, Inc, 501 c 3 non profit organization founded in 2010 to meet the needs of the autistic community children and families who were suffering from instabilities caused by a lack of support. Over the next few years, Hope 4 Autism will expand its efforts offerings it’s Not-So-Typical Autism Support Groups & the Autism Family center, and will work with public and private foundations, schools and families.

Programs that supports our mission:

1.) Your Not-So-Typical Autism Support Groups focus on parents connecting with what’s truly important to them and to open up new possibilities in their lives, with the use of real life coaching.

2.) Wellness Center focuses on the state and condition of being in good physical and mental health. Our goal is to assist our clients with living more fulfilling, healthy and active lifestyles.

 

3.) Community Services offer blogs and autism newsletters (includes resource listing of services available to low income families); autism awareness & charity events: Strut 4 Autism & Hugs 4 Autism Charity Benefits.

While there are several other autism support groups for families in the Greater Hartford Region, including three chapters of the Autism Society of America, no group focuses on a groups with structure that focuses on caregivers transitioning their lives towards greater meaning, passion and positive contribution. A partnership with personal life coach makes this structured group possible.


Hope 4 Autism’s new operating budget for 2013 will total $20,000 and is projected to serve 1,000 families. Hope 4 Autism will be funded by individual donors, supports, grants and charity benefits. Hope 4 Autism is governed by a Board of Directors composed of five individuals from the Greater Hartford Region. All Board of Directors serve on a strict volunteer basis and either have a child or relative in their family who is diagnosed with autism.
